The Basics of Weeks and Days
Before we explore the length of 4 weeks, let’s understand the basic units of time. A week consists of seven days. Each day is made up of 24 hours. This means that a week contains 7 * 24 = 168 hours.
Calculating 4 Weeks in Days and Hours
If we want to calculate how many days are in 4 weeks, we simply multiply the number of weeks by the number of days in a week. So, 4 weeks * 7 days per week = 28 days.
Similarly, to find out how many hours are in 4 weeks, we multiply the number of days in 4 weeks by 24 hours in a day. Therefore, 28 days * 24 hours per day = 672 hours.

How Long is 4 Weeks Compared to Other Time Periods?
Weeks vs. Months
While 4 weeks make up a month in most cases, it’s essential to note that not all months have the same number of days. Some months have 30 days, while others have 31 days.
Weeks vs. Years
In the context of a year, 4 weeks only represent a small fraction of the total time. There are 52 weeks in a year, so 4 weeks make up less than 8% of a year.
